Step-by-Step Process

1

Access Reports

Begin by navigating to the reports section where you can find templates and create custom reports.

  • Open QuickBooks and go to Reports in the left navigation menu.
  • Click on Custom Reports to access the reporting tools.
  • Select Create New Report to begin customizing your report.
  • Choose the type of report you want to create (e.g., transaction, summary, or detail).

2

Customize Your Report

Next, tailor the report to fit your specific needs by selecting the desired fields and filters.

  • Utilize the fields on the right to add or remove columns from your report.
  • Set date ranges or filters to narrow down the data displayed.
  • Apply sorting options to organize the data according to your preferences.
  • Review your selections to ensure your report aligns with your objectives.

3

Save and Run Report

Once you are satisfied with your customizations, save the report and run it to view your results.

  • Click on the Save Customization button to keep your report settings.
  • Name your report for easy identification in the future.
  • Run the report by clicking on the Run Report button.
  • Review the generated report for accuracy and insights.

4

Export or Share Report

Finally, decide how you want to utilize the report by exporting or sharing it with your team.

  • Use the Export button to download your report in various formats like Excel or PDF.
  • Share the report directly via email using the Email option.
  • Schedule automatic email reports to keep stakeholders updated.
  • Review feedback from your team to improve future reports.

Common Mistakes

Even experienced users can make errors when creating custom reports in QuickBooks Online. Here are some common pitfalls to avoid:

  • Failing to set the correct date ranges, which can result in incomplete or misleading data.
  • Overlooking necessary filters, making the report too broad and less actionable.
  • Neglecting to save your customization, leading to loss of work during future sessions.
  • Not reviewing the report after running, which can result in missed errors or discrepancies.

Can I save my custom reports for future use?

Yes, once you create a custom report in QuickBooks Online, you can save it for future use. After customizing your report, simply click on the Save Customization button and give your report a name. This allows you to easily access the report later without having to recreate it from scratch.

Is there a way to automate custom reports?

Yes, QuickBooks Online allows users to schedule automatic email reports. After creating your custom report, you can choose the option to schedule it to be sent to specific recipients on a recurring basis. This feature ensures that stakeholders receive timely updates without manual intervention.
